What Is Autodesk Construction Cloud?

Autodesk Construction Cloud functions as an integrated ecosystem rather than a standalone application. It brings together tools for project oversight, document management, model coordination, cost control, and on-site collaboration within a single platform. Establishing a shared source of project information allows everyone involved to work from the most current data. This connected approach helps minimise mistakes, strengthens accountability, and enables teams to make clearer, more informed decisions at every stage of a project.

Autodesk Construction Cloud Pricing Overview

Autodesk Construction Cloud uses a subscription-based pricing model designed to be flexible rather than one-size-fits-all. Costs can vary based on the tools a company chooses, the number of users who need access, and the extent of platform use. Organisations can subscribe to individual products or opt for bundled solutions that span several phases of the construction process. This structure makes it easier for teams to align spending with project scale and operational needs, without paying for features they do not require.

Factors That Influence Pricing

Several key factors shape the cost of Autodesk Construction Cloud. Pricing varies based on the number of users who need access, the selected tools, and whether subscriptions are purchased separately or bundled. The length of the subscription also plays a role, as longer commitments often come with better overall value. Since every organisation has different needs and project requirements, pricing is usually customised rather than fixed.

Autodesk Construction Cloud App

The Autodesk Construction Cloud mobile app brings core platform features directly to smartphones and tablets, making it easier for teams to work while on the move. Field staff can view drawings, documents, schedules, and open issues straight from the job site, without relying on printed materials or office access. The app also allows users to record updates, take photos, mark up plans, and communicate instantly with office teams. This level of mobility helps teams respond faster, reduce delays, and ensure accurate information flows between the site and the office.
